lets see:
1 US gallon = 0.133680556 cubic feet
concrete weights about 150 lbs / cu ft.
145 lbs unreinforced.
145 x .133680556 = 19.38368062 lbs
depending upon the type of concrete and the mix rate, a gallon of concrete weighs anywhere from 17-20 lbs. So 85 to 100lbs plus the weight of the bucket.

On average: a gallon of diesel fuel weighs about 7 pounds, a gallon of kerosene weighs around 6.8 pounds, and a gallon of gasoline weighs approximately 6.3 pounds. These weights can vary slightly depending on the specific composition and temperature of the fuel.
The weight of a gallon can vary depending on its contents, but as a general rule of thumb, 1 gallon of water weighs approximately 8.34 pounds.
The weight of a 375-gallon propane tank will vary depending on the level of propane it contains. Propane weighs about 4.2 pounds per gallon. Therefore, a full 375-gallon propane tank would weigh approximately 1,575 pounds.
